Ladybird Beetle
Description:
Ladybird beetle (Coccinella septempunctata) feeding on aphids. Ladybirds belong to the order known as Coleoptera in which more than 290,000 species are classified. Coccinella septempunctata is about 7mm long, has very short antennae, and despite its short legs is a very good runner. It is a zealous and voracious aphid hunter. Magnification is x3 at 35mm.
